How much do barista starting j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for barista starting in the United States is $15.55,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.66 and $16.83 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

How to get hired as a barista starting with no experience?

To get hired as a starting barista with no experience, focus on demonstrating enthusiasm for coffee and customer service in your application and interview. Highlight transferable skills like communication, teamwork, and a positive attitude, and consider completing a basic food safety or customer service certification to strengthen your candidacy.

Can you get a starting barista job without experience?

Yes, many entry-level barista positions do not require prior experience. Employers often provide on-the-job training and look for qualities like good communication, customer service skills, and a positive attitude. Having a high school diploma or equivalent can also be beneficial.

Is being a barista starting a good first job?

Being a barista is often considered a good first job because it provides experience in customer service, communication, and multitasking. It typically requires basic skills, can offer flexible hours, and may provide training on coffee preparation and point-of-sale systems.

What are some common challenges new baristas face when starting out, and how can they overcome them?

New baristas often find it challenging to master the pace of a busy café, learn the menu, and consistently prepare drinks to standard. Building muscle memory for equipment use and multitasking during rush hours can take time. To overcome these challenges, it helps to observe experienced colleagues, ask questions, and practice proper techniques during slower periods. Embracing feedback and staying organized will also help you become more confident and efficient in your role.

What does a barista do?

A Barista is responsible for preparing and serving coffee and espresso-based drinks, such as lattes, cappuccinos, and mochas, in cafes or coffee shops. They also handle customer service tasks, including taking orders, answering questions about the menu, and handling payments. Additionally, Baristas maintain the cleanliness of their work area, operate and clean coffee machines, and sometimes assist with restocking supplies or light food preparation. Their role is essential in creating a welcoming atmosphere and ensuring customer satisfaction.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a barista,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Barista, you need basic knowledge of coffee preparation, attention to detail, and customer service skills, often gained through on-the-job training or food service experience. Familiarity with espresso machines, grinders, POS systems, and food safety protocols is typically required. Strong communication, teamwork, and the ability to multitask under pressure are standout soft skills in this role. These skills ensure efficient service, positive customer experiences, and smooth café operations in a fast-paced environment.
